    Abstract:

    Aiming at the problems such as the difficulty of measuring the angle of traffic sign installation and the single measurement method. Through YOLOv8 object detection accuracy experiments, the model is made to have an accurate object detection frame to ensure the accuracy of signage pixel coordinates. In this paper, iterative geometric encoder stereo matching model (IGEV) is introduced to improve the binocular ranging model using migration learning. Ranging experiments were set up in 1.5m, 2.0m, 2.5m and 3m four distance variables, after the experiments to verify the accuracy of the ranging model, and the true distance value compared with the ranging error rate of 0.67%; sign installation angle experiments proved that all the error rate of the angular measurement is less than 7.62%. This paper method sign installation angle measurement method intelligent.
